Polymer physics is a key part of macromolecular science. This textbook presents the elements of this important branch of materials science in the style of a series of lectures." The main focus lays on the concepts, rather than on experimental techniques and theo retical methods. Written for graduate students of physics, materials science and chemical engineering, as well as for researchers in academia and industry entering this fielcJ, the book introduces and discusses the basic phenomena that lead to the peculiar physical properties of polymeric systems. [Pg.519]
